History of our house
I've found some really cool pictures of our house on the website of the Haarlem Picture Archive (Archiefdienst Kennemerland).
To see all the pictures of our house online click here and search on "Haarlem, Hooimarkt". Here is a selection of the most interesting pictures.
1/12: June 25th, 1980. A fire, probably caused by a pan forgotten on the stove, destroys most of the building.

7/12: The upper floor of the building (where now our apartment is) is completely ruined.
8/12: However, the structure of the building still stands. Some of the wood is kept in place and will be used again for the rebuilding.
9/12: Three years after the fire, in 1983, the building is not renovated yet but it looks like they're working on it.
10/12: The house before the fire, in 1966.
11/12: The house in 1915.
12/12: In 1960 there was still a fruit- and vegetables market in our street; here's a picture of the Friese Varkensmarkt.
